Job Description Summary:

Provides technical support for outpatient pharmacy with the processing of prescription orders along with preparation and dispensing of patient medications within the three outpatient pharmacies.

Job Description:

Essential Functions:

  • Accepts prescriptions, establishes billing/patient charges, documents patients’ allergies correctly, interprets and enters information regarding the outpatient prescription into the computer system.
  • Serves as call center agent; answers the telephone and assists caller or forwards to appropriate individual (pharmacist, pharmacy administration, etc.).
  • Prepares and packages medications for outpatient use.
  • Independently resolves on-line adjudication problems with third party payors.
  • Replenishes pharmacy stock area and notifies inventory coordinators of concerns.

Education Requirement:

As required by listed licensure and/or certification requirement.

Licensure Requirement:

Board of Pharmacy Technician License (Registered or Certified) Technician Trainee accepted with expectation of incumbent to become registered or certified within 90 days of hire.

Certifications:

Certification as a pharmacy technician or documented passing score on certification exam prior to start date (CPhT, ExCPT), required.

Skills:

Demonstrated skills in algebra by passing score on math competency administered on site.

Experience:

Six months of previous pharmacy experience, preferred.

Physical Requirements:

OCCASIONALLY: Biohazard waste, Interpreting Data, Lifting / Carrying: 11-20 lbs, Machinery, Pushing / Pulling: 0-25 lbs, Sitting

FREQUENTLY: Bend/twist, Communicable Diseases and/or Pathogens, Decision Making, Lifting / Carrying: 0-10 lbs, Problem solving, Squat/kneel

CONTINUOUSLY: Audible speech, Chemicals/Medications, Color vision, Computer skills, Depth perception, Flexing/extending of neck, Hand use: grasping, gripping, turning, Hearing acuity, Peripheral vision, Reaching above shoulder, Repetitive hand/arm use, Seeing – Far/near, Standing, Walking
